ET25SWG0008 - Gas Hybrid Heat Pump
This study aims to provide additional system performance testing for a prototype dual fuel hybrid heat pump for the residential sector. Developed by a major OEM, this 120 V heat pump is equipped with a gas combustion burner to maximize efficiency and performance. This eliminates the need for expensive 240 V panel upgrades and addresses the size and recovery limitations of 120 V heat pump water heaters. The system is a TRL 8 with prototypes constructed and tested by the OEM which leverages their existing commercially available 120 V electric heat pump water heater form factor. This technology is designed to operate under the electric heat pump system during routine usage, however, during times of peak demand or tank depletion, the natural gas burner will be leveraged.
